Job description

We have a fantastic opportunity for a Maintenance Technician to join a global business at one of the UK manufacturing plants producing some of the UK's most loved food products. Engineers are the heartbeat of everything we do.

The plants are complex, fast-moving environments where no two shifts are ever the same. Working as part of the Shift Manufacturing Maintenance team, the Maintenance Technician is instrumental in the day-to-day efficient operation of machinery and equipment in their area of responsibility.

Being assigned to specific plant equipment, the Maintenance Technician will analyse performance trends and lead Continuous Improvement activity to ensure optimum plant efficiency whether it be mechanical, electrical or programming the cause of the issue.

You must be flexible to work 12-hour shifts of days and nights.

In return for your Maintenance skills and experience, we offer for the Maintenance Technician:

  • Up to £54,000 depending on experience
  • An excellent salary sacrifices pension scheme where we'll contribute double what you do, up to a maximum of 12% of your pay.
  • 25 days' annual leave from day one plus bank holidays (increasing with service), with the option to buy and sell up to 5 days per year
  • Medicash health cash plan claim money back on everyday healthcare costs including dental, optical, and physiotherapy, with 24/7 virtual GP access and mental health support
  • Life insurance cover providing peace of mind for you and your family
  • Enhanced maternity and paternity pay

You must hold a minimum NVQ Level 3/ BTEC Level 3, or City & Guilds Part 3 in a relevant engineering discipline such as Electrical or Mechanical. A time-served apprenticeship is very desirable along with a HNC.

Some duties for the Maintenance Technician role will involve:

  • Complete planned and reactive maintenance tasks and improvement work with designated area.
  • To record and interpret machinery efficiencies relating to Safety, Quality, Delivery and Cost, and provide immediate corrective actions for both the short term and longer-term preventative measures
  • To liaise with area Planner to ensure that planned maintenance activity is planned accordingly and with mind for bettering area performance (for Safety, Quality, Delivery and Cost) and assist in the delivery of this as required.
  • Enter accurate, detailed feedback on all completed tasks into SAP daily.

The role of Maintenance Technician role is commutable from Peterborough, Whittlesey, Wisbech, Chatteris and Huntingdon.
